The Wine Advocate:

The 2016 Cantariña 1 La Tintorera is still sold without an appellation of origin, but I guess in the future it will carry it, as the grape was finally allowed to produce varietal wines. This is unusually pale and moderate in alcohol (12%) compared with its siblings. It has varietal character, good acidity and abundant, fine-grained tannins. I found more balance and elegance here than in many of their Mencías... 1,500 bottles were filled in December 2017.
